- The distance between Nowra Ran, Australia and Kozhikode, India is approximately 9,371 km or 5,824 mi.
- To reach Nowra Ran in this distance one would set out from Kozhikode bearing 127.4°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Nowra Ran bearing 108° or ESE .
- Nowra Ran has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Kozhikode has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Nowra Ran is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Kozhikode is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 11.2 °C (20.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.3 °C (11.3°F) more in Nowra Ran.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1895.6 mm (74.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1895.6 l/m² (46.52 US gal/ft²) or 18,956,000 l/ha (2,026,522 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.9° lower in Nowra Ran than in Kozhikode.
